What's wrong with this script

I am trying to create a script but it is giving me errors on Cygwin for the following script. Could someone tell me, what am I doing wrong?

choice=1000
echo "choice is $choice"
while [ $choice -ne 0 ]; do
echo "choice is $choice"
echo 'Please select your option:'
echo '1. Option 1'
echo '2. Option 2'
echo 'Enter the number:'
read choice
echo "choice is $choice"

if [ $choice -eq 1]; then
echo "You selected option 1"
choice=0
elif [$choice -eq 2]; then
echo "You selected option 2"
choice=0
else
echo "You have entered a wrong choice. Please choose from the options given"
choice=1000
fi
done
echo "Completed."


Response that I get is:
choice is 1000
choice is 1000
Please select your option:
1. Option 1
2. Option 2
Enter the number:
1
choice is 1
[: missing ]
[1: not found
You have entered a wrong choice. Please choose from the options given
choice is 1000
Please select your option:
1. Option 1
2. Option 2
Enter the number:

I think it is not taking $choice as integer in the condition box, but i am not sure.

NAME
Config::Model::models::LCDd::CFontz - Configuration class LCDd::CFontz VERSION
version 2.021 DESCRIPTION
Configuration classes used by Config::Model generated from LCDd.conf Elements Device Select the output device to use Optional. Type uniline. upstream_default: '/dev/lcd'. Size Select the LCD size Optional. Type uniline. upstream_default: '20x4'. Contrast Set the initial contrast Optional. Type integer. upstream_default: '560'. Brightness Set the initial brightness Optional. Type integer. upstream_default: '1000'. OffBrightness Set the initial off-brightness This value is used when the display is normally switched off in case LCDd is inactive. Optional. Type integer. upstream_default: '0'. Speed Set the communication speed Optional. Type enum. choice: '1200', '2400', '9600', '19200', '115200'. upstream_default: '9600'. NewFirmware Set the firmware version (New means >= 2.0) Optional. Type enum. choice: 'yes', 'no'. upstream_default: 'no'. Reboot Reinitialize the LCD's BIOS normally you shouldn't need this. Optional. Type enum. choice: 'yes', 'no'. upstream_default: 'no'. SEE ALSO
